Job description
We are currently seeking a seasoned Chemical Process Engineer F/M/X to lead transformative improvements in production performance by diagnosing operational processes, integrating new work methodologies, and deploying advanced production management tools, processes, and behaviors. The ideal candidate will have a strong technical background in chemical engineering and possess the ability to effectively enhance organizational capabilities within a large-scale manufacturing environment. The project is based in Basel and Manchesteron-site, and allows for some remote flexibility. Up to 50% international travel is required.
🔥Responsibilities:
- Diagnose operational discipline in areas such as maintenance, production performance, and team behaviors.
- Identify improvement opportunities and develop innovative solutions to drive efficiency and productivity.
- Enhance organizational capabilities by designing and implementing new tools and standardized practices.
- Conduct training for employees and coach leaders on best practices to build a sustainable culture of excellence.
- Work closely with cross-functional experts to integrate new capabilities, including tools, processes, and behavioral standards.
- Ensure seamless adoption of new methods across production lines.
- Conduct audits and identify areas for improvement.
- Develop and implement continuous improvement recommendations to ensure long-term success.
🎯Your Profile:
- You have a Bachelor's or advanced degree in Chemical Engineering, Process Engineering, or related field.
- You have a minimum of 10 years of experience as a Chemical Process Engineer or in a similar role within the chemical or similar industries.
- You have proven expertise in diagnosing and improving chemical production processes, with a strong foundation in Lean Six Sigma and operational excellence.
- You have proficiency in manufacturing excellence methodologies and production management systems.
- You have strong analytical abilities for process analysis and identifying improvement opportunities.
- You have excellent communication and influencing skills, with a proven ability to lead cross-functional initiatives.
- Ideally, you are familiar with Industry 4.0 concepts and digital production management tools.
